Linux环境下快速修改SQL技巧
linux 修改sql

作者:IIS7AI 时间:2025-02-12 00:55



Linux环境下高效修改SQL语句:深度解析与实践指南 在当今数据驱动的时代,数据库管理系统的优化与维护直接关系到企业数据处理的效率与安全性

    Linux,作为广泛采用的服务器操作系统,为数据库管理员(DBA)提供了一个强大而灵活的平台来执行各种数据库操作,包括SQL语句的修改与优化

    本文将深入探讨在Linux环境下如何高效、安全地修改SQL语句,涵盖基础准备、实战技巧以及最佳实践,旨在帮助DBA和开发人员提升数据库管理效能

     一、Linux环境下的数据库管理基础 在深入探讨SQL语句修改之前,了解Linux环境下的数据库管理基础至关重要

    Linux以其稳定性、安全性和强大的命令行工具而闻名,为数据库如MySQL、PostgreSQL、Oracle等提供了理想的运行环境

     1.安装与配置:在Linux系统上安装数据库软件通常涉及下载安装包、配置依赖项、执行安装命令等步骤

    例如,使用`apt`(Debian/Ubuntu)或`yum`(RHEL/CentOS)包管理器可以轻松安装MySQL

    配置阶段则涉及设置数据库服务、创建用户和权限管理等

     2.命令行工具:Linux命令行是管理数据库的强大工具

    如`mysql`命令行客户端用于与MySQL数据库交互,`psql`用于PostgreSQL

    这些工具允许用户执行SQL查询、管理数据库对象、监控性能等

     3.文件与目录管理:Linux的文件系统结构对于数据库管理同样重要

    配置文件(如`/etc/mysql/my.cnf`)、日志文件和数据文件通常存放在特定目录下,了解这些位置有助于故障排查和性能调优

     二、SQL语句修改前的准备工作 在动手修改SQL语句之前,充分的准备工作能够确保操作的高效与安全

     1.备份数据库:任何对数据库的修改都应以备份为前提

    使用如`mysqldump`、`pg_dump`等工具创建数据库的完整备份,以防不测

     2.分析现有SQL:使用EXPLAIN或`EXPLAIN ANALYZE`命令分析现有SQL语句的执行计划,识别性能瓶颈

    这有助于确定哪些SQL语句需要优化

     3.测试环境:在修改SQL之前,先在测试环境中进行验证

    这可以确保修改不会影响数据的完整性和应用程序的功能

     三、Linux环境下修改SQL的实战技巧 1.直接编辑SQL脚本: - 使用Linux文本编辑器如`vim`、`nano`或图形化界面的编辑器(如VSCode通过SSH连接)直接编辑存储过程、触发器或批处理SQL脚本

     - 编辑完成后,通过命令行工具执行修改后的SQL文件,如`mysql -u username -pdatabase_name